Today we make our debut column with a resident we are proud to promote: Will Song, owner and head chef of Rogers Park’s bopNgrill.

bopNgrill first opened in Evanston in 2009 after Will realized he didn’t want to follow his career path into the fine dining. As a professionally educated and trained chef, Will wanted to offer food he likes: burgers, fries, rice, eggs and kimchi, among other ingredients. Much to his chagrin, the counter-service restaurant was a hit. Last August, Will decided to open his second bopNgrill location right here in Rogers Park (6604 N Sheridan). The dedicated owner devoted nearly every waking hour to building a fanbase in the neighborhood.

“I was sleeping in the back of the restaurant,” says Song. “I remember one night we had some freezer issue that made the room very loud and wet. I thought, ‘I can’t live like this anymore.’” Song did what anyone would: look for the best living options as close to the Rogers Park location as possible.

“The Morgan is really the ideal place to live in the neighborhood,” explains Song. “It’s so close to work, and it is the nicest complex in the area. I’m happy and proud to live in a great community.”

We’re not the only one who has noticed. Since opening, bopNgrill has received praise and coverage from Chicago Tribune, Redeye, ABC 7, Time Out Chicago, and most recently, the Food Network. The Korean-inspired burgers is set to appear on Guy Fieri’s Diners, Drive-Ins and Dives next week, August 13, 14 and 24.

“We’re looking forward to the episode airing,” says Song. “We know it will be great for business and of course the Rogers Park neighborhood.”

When asked if he has any future plans for his brand, Song showed that he has a good head on his shoulders. “We’re not going anywhere just yet. My big focus is to weather our planned upswing in business. We look forward to serving the Rogers Park area for a while to come.”
